Unlocking Funding Options: Unsecured vs. Secured Loans

Navigating the world of financing can be a daunting challenge. Whether you're a budding entrepreneur or an established organization, understanding the various funding options available is crucial for success. Two primary categories of loans stand out: unsecured and secured.

Unsecured loans, as the name suggests, don't necessitate any guarantees. They rely on your reputation to assess the likelihood of repayment. These loans are often accessible with quicker disbursement processes, making them a popular choice for short-term funding needs.

Secured loans, on the other hand, require collateral to mitigate the lender's exposure. This asset serves as a protection for the lender in case of missed payments. Secured loans typically offer competitive interest rates due to the reduced risk, making them suitable for larger funding requirements.

Understanding the advantages and disadvantages of each loan type is essential for making an informed choice. Carefully consider your financial situation, needs, and risk tolerance before committing on this important step.

Funding Your Dream: A Guide to Mortgage Loans

Securing a mortgage financing can seem like a daunting task, but it doesn't have to be. With careful planning and research, you can navigate the process efficiently.

A mortgage allows you to obtain your dream home by giving a large loan that is repaid over time. Understanding the different varieties of mortgages available and the factors that determine your interest rate can empower you to make an intelligent decision.

Before applying for a mortgage, it's crucial to assess your financial position. Examine your income, expenses, and credit history to get a clear picture of what you can manage.

Once you have a solid understanding of your finances, it's time to explore options for the best mortgage conditions. Don't be afraid to ask questions from multiple lenders to ensure you comprehend all the provisions of the loan.

When selecting a lender and mortgage program, you'll need to file a formal application. This usually involves providing detailed financial information, such as pay stubs, bank statements, and tax returns.

A mortgage processor will then review your application to verify your eligibility for the loan. If your application is granted, you'll receive a loan approval. This document outlines the final terms of your mortgage, including the interest rate, monthly payment amount, and loan term.

The final step in the mortgage process involves closing on your new home. Closing is when you officially exchange ownership of the property and make the outstanding payment for the mortgage.

Throughout this journey, remember that it's important to stay informed with your lender and ask questions whenever you need guidance. By following these steps, you can successfully navigate the mortgage process and achieve your dream of homeownership.
